Asher, Oklahoma Asher is a town in Pottawatomie County, Oklahoma, United States. The population was 393 at the 2010 census, a decline of 6.2 percent from 419 at the 2000 census. (...) Avoca, Oklahoma Avoca was a small town in Avoca Township, located in southeastern Pottawatomie County, Oklahoma Territory. The post office was established in 1894 and closed permanently in 1906. (...) Avoca Township, Pottawatomie County, Oklahoma Avoca Township was located in Pottawatomie County, Oklahoma. It should not be confused with Avoca, which was a smaller community inside the township. (...) Oklahoma's at-large congressional seat In 1913, Oklahoma was apportioned three additional congressional seats. For just the 63rd Congress, those three members represented the state At-large. In 1933, Oklahoma was apportioned one additional seat. For the 73rd through the 77th congresses, Will Rogers held the seat at-large (...) |
